Mother's Favorite Makeup Color
The Monday blues stenched
The household walls
With cheap alcohol
It seem as if a storm scotched
The romantic view of a sunset
I stepped foot into My parent's room
Father asleep and mother on her feet
Her eyes completely fixed on the mirror
As she puffed up her sheathy make up
It was the same make up color
She wore every Monday
That purple hazy
Bruise like color
She seemed so fond of
I woke up mid Sunday night
To a storm descending into
The household halls
Bellowing echoes
Of un sobered liquor
It's thundering flare
Shed heartless words
That left a bloody path
Of lead leading to
My parents room
I dragged myself
To their door with
Fear still stuck
beneath my fingertips
As I turned the nob open
My eyes gawked as
my father's hands
Turned into makeup puffs
Each dab stained purple powder
Onto the flesh of my mother
It was at this point when
I learned purple wasn't Mother’s favorite makeup color
